C++ stringstream set precision

WebApr 8, 2024 · Syntax of find () The find () function is a member of the string class in C++. It has the following syntax: string::size_type find (const string& str, size_type pos = 0) const noexcept; Let's break down this syntax into its component parts: string::size_type is a data type that represents the size of a string. It is an unsigned integer type. WebApr 6, 2024 · Conclusion: In summary, a custom assignment operator in C++ can be useful in cases where the default operator is insufficient or when resource management, memory allocation, or inheritance requires special attention. It can help avoid issues such as memory leaks, shallow copies, or undesired behaviour due to differences in object states.

std::setprecision - cppreference.com

Weboutput in a more general form. The precision stays changed until you change it again. Setting the precision to zero with: cout.precision(0); or cout << setprecision(0); restores … Webbasic_stringstream. Array I/O: basic_ispanstream (C++23) basic_ospanstream ... ios_base & str, int n) {// set width str. width (n);} Notes. The width property of the stream will be reset to zero (meaning "unspecified") if any of the following functions are called: ... The following behavior-changing defect reports were applied retroactively to ... hillsong mp3 archive https://login-informatica.com

C++ tcp client server example - TAE

WebNov 10, 2024 · The useful input/output manipulators are std::setbase, std::setw and std::setfill. These are defined in and are quite useful functions. std::base : Set basefield flag; Sets the base-field to one of its possible values: dec, hex or oct according to argument base. Syntax : std::setbase (int base) ; decimal : if base is 10 hexadecimal : if base is ... WebDec 26, 2024 · default precision: 6 maximum precision: 19 precision: pi: 0 3 1 3 2 3.1 3 3.14 4 3.142 5 3.1416 6 3.14159 7 3.141593 8 3.1415927 9 3.14159265 10 … WebMar 28, 2014 · Your code doesn't do what the OP asked for, it merely displays the value, it doesn't "get the value to 2 decimal places and assign this 2 decimal place value to a different variable". Besides, calling precision or using the setprecision manipulator is exactly the same thing, you haven't shown anything new. hillsong ministry

wstringstream - cplusplus.com - The C++ Resources Network

Category:C++ (Cpp) stringstream::precision Examples

Tags:C++ stringstream set precision

C++ stringstream set precision

What are C++ Manipulators (endl, setw, setprecision, setf)?

WebC Vs C++ C++ Comments C++ Data Abstraction C++ Identifier C++ Memory Management C++ Storage Classes C++ Void Pointer C++ Array To Function C++ Expressions C++ Features C++ Interfaces C++ Encapsulation std::min in C++ External merge sort in C++ Remove duplicates from sorted array in C++ Precision of floating point numbers Using … WebC++11 (fenv.h) (float.h) C++11 (inttypes.h) (iso646.h) ... This is an instantiation of basic_stringstream with the following template …

C++ stringstream set precision

Did you know?

WebC++ (Cpp) stringstream::precision - 8 examples found. These are the top rated real world C++ (Cpp) examples of std ... (std::stringstream &amp;ss, double input) { #ifdef _MSC_VER … WebMar 17, 2024 · 3. String to int Conversion Using stringstream Class. The stringstream class in C++ allows us to associate a string to be read as if it were a stream. We can use it to easily convert strings of digits into ints, floats, or doubles. The stringstream class is defined inside the header file.. It works similar to other input and output …

WebFeb 11, 2024 · What are C++ Manipulators (endl, setw, setprecision, setf)? Stream Manipulators are functions specifically designed to be used in conjunction with the insertion (&lt;&lt;) and extraction (&gt;&gt;) operators on stream objects, for example −. They are still regular functions and can also be called as any other function using a stream object as an … WebC++ (Cpp) StringStream::precision - 3 examples found. These are the top rated real world C++ (Cpp) examples of StringStream::precision extracted from open source projects. …

WebMar 12, 2024 · 可以使用 cout.precision(n) 控制输出精度,其中 n 为保留的小数位数。 如果你想要整数保留整数,小数保留后两位,可以使用流控制符 fixed 和 setprecision(n)。示例代码如下: ```c++ cout &lt;&lt; fixed &lt;&lt; setprecision(2) &lt;&lt; x; ``` 其中 x 是需要输出的数字。 WebFeb 25, 2010 · 1. it depend on number of "decimal component" you have in data. std::numeric_limits::digits10 will give the maximum number of "floating component". …

WebC++ std::lower_bound不是专为红黑树迭代器设计的,有什么技术原因吗?,c++,algorithm,c++11,stl,binary-search-tree,C++,Algorithm,C++11,Stl,Binary Search Tree,如果我向它传递一对红黑树迭代器(set::iterator或map::iterator),我总是假设std::lower_bound()以对数时间运行。

WebApr 11, 2024 · Standard input/output (I/O) streams are an important part of the C++ iostream library, and are used for performing basic input/output operations in C++ programs. The three most commonly used standard streams are cin, cout, and cerr. cin is the standard input stream, which is used to read data from the console or another input device. smart looking catWebA set of internal flags that affect how certain input/output operations are interpreted or generated. See member type fmtflags. field width: width: Width of the next formatted … smart looking shedsWebdouble to String with Custom Precision using ostringstream. Header file Required. #include To convert Double to String with Custom Precision set precision in … smart long sleeve polo shirtsWebApr 10, 2024 · Conclusion. The C++ setprecision function is used to format floating-point values. This is an inbuilt function and can be used by importing the iomanip library in a … smart lotion eczemaWebOct 15, 2012 · A better demonstration arises with a value of 1.0/3.0. With the default precision you get a string representation of "0.333333". This is not the string equivalent … smart long sleeve topsWebHere is the solution that works with any precision setting. To get precision to 2 decimal places in sstream here is my code snippet. Examples 3.444 will be 3.44, 1.10 will be … smart look landscapingWebFeb 18, 2024 · Syntax: setprecision (int n) Parameters: This method accepts n as a parameter which is the integer argument corresponding to which the floating-point … hillsong ministries